public void GetMapPoints_ItemIdPassed_ShouldCallRepositoryWithItem(IMapPointRepository mapPointRepository, [FakeDb.AutoFixture.Content] Data.Items.Item item) { var controller = new MapsController(mapPointRepository); controller.GetMapPoints(item.ID.Guid); mapPointRepository.GetAll(item).ReceivedWithAnyArgs(1); }
public JsonResult GetMapPoints(Guid itemId) { var item = Context.Database.GetItem(new ID(itemId)); var points = mapPointRepository.GetAll(item); return(Json(points)); }
public void GetMapPoints_ItemIdPassed_PointsReturnedFormRepo(IMapPointRepository mapPointRepository, Db db, MapPoint[] points,[FakeDb.AutoFixture.Content]Data.Items.Item item) { mapPointRepository.GetAll(null).ReturnsForAnyArgs(points); var controller = new MapsController(mapPointRepository); var actualPoints = controller.GetMapPoints(item.ID.Guid).Data as IEnumerable<MapPoint>; actualPoints.ShouldBeEquivalentTo(points); }
public void GetMapPoints_ItemIdPassed_PointsReturnedFormRepo(IMapPointRepository mapPointRepository, Db db, MapPoint[] points, [FakeDb.AutoFixture.Content] Data.Items.Item item) { mapPointRepository.GetAll(null).ReturnsForAnyArgs(points); var controller = new MapsController(mapPointRepository); var actualPoints = controller.GetMapPoints(item.ID.Guid).Data as IEnumerable <MapPoint>; actualPoints.ShouldBeEquivalentTo(points); }
public JsonResult Get(bool?getall) { List <MapPoint> mapData = db.GetAll(getall.HasValue && getall.Value); return(Json(mapData)); }
public void GetMapPoints_ItemIdPassed_ShouldCallRepositoryWithItem(IMapPointRepository mapPointRepository, [FakeDb.AutoFixture.Content]Data.Items.Item item) { var controller = new MapsController(mapPointRepository); controller.GetMapPoints(item.ID.Guid); mapPointRepository.GetAll(item).ReceivedWithAnyArgs(1); }